>>I know that I can change the class of a form with the class browser.
>>
>>Is there a tool that would let me change the class of objects within a form? Once upon a time I knew how to do it manually with use MyForm.scx and then modifying the fields classloc, baseclass and objname. I tried that approach yesterday and it didn't go well ;-) I had a backup so no harm done.
>>
>>So is there a tool that would let me those changes without me hacking manually?
>
>Update
>
>I found it in the Thor tools
>
>Parent Class
>Re-Define parent class

Was also available in class browser - rclick on the class in the treeview, and select the redefine option. The GUI you get is awful, you have to navigate all the way through and may accidentally pull a wrong class from a classlib, but once you train yourself it works.
